Author name: Lesley Gale

Lesley has been in love with skydiving for 35 years. She is a multiple world and national record holder and a coach on 20 successful record events worldwide. She has over 100 competition medals spanning more than 25 years and has been on the British 8-way National team at World events. She started Skydive Mag to spread knowledge, information and passion about our amazing sport. TESLA Release Video

Fluid Wings release their new canopy, the Tesla, designed for the recreational swooper, and those learning to swoop. Scott Roberts and Kevin Hintze discuss its characteristics.
